CHURCH IN GERMANY
BISHOP ORDERED TO APPEAR BEFORE CHANCELLOR Prm Anocittion—By Telegraph—Copyright, BERLIN, January 14. (Received January 16, at 1 a.m.) Bishop Muller has been ordered to appear before Herr Hitler on January 17, and on this interview depends bis continuance in office. The Emergency Federation resolved in favour of allowing the Press to report church troubles and demanded Bishop Muller’s immediate resignation.
